J&K gets 16th rank in KIYG

JAMMU: With 14 medals to their tally, the Union Territory of Jammu and Kashmir secured 16th rank in the 36 participating units in the Khelo India Youth Games (KIYG) hosted by Haryana at Panchkula The J&K medal tally of 14, included three gold, five silver and six bronze. The top position went to hosts Haryana with record 903 medals, including 269 gold. Maharashtra was too far in terms of the tally with 137 medals to secure overall second place while Karnataka finished third with 67 medals. Three participating units of Lakshadeep, Nagaland and Sikkim could not open their accounts while UT of Ladakh earned 30th rank with one silver and three bronze medals.
